I am leader of the Oast House Community Choir (OHCC), which meets every Tuesday 10am – 11:30 during term time. In 2024 and 2025, the OHCC was involved in contributing to ‘Hulked‘ – a project masterminded by Anna Braithwaite and Jeremy Scott – and the OHCC regularly perform some of the songs and poetry that this project produced.
In 2019 and 2020, I was Music Leader of the innovative project Sea Folk Sing. This produced several unique songs about the Medway and Swale waterways and the nearby sea, which the OHCC regularly perform.
In 2015 and 2016, I was co-director of the folk opera ‘Hopping Down in Kent‘ with Dave Woodward, also of the Acoustic Architects. See link to a rough video of the first performance which we performed at The Old Brewery Store in Faversham in November 2015. We also performed ‘Hopping Down in Kent’ in 2016, in the week running up to the Faversham Hop Festival (Wednesday 31st August), again at The Old Brewery Store in Faversham. We also performed some of the songs of HDIK during the opening ceremony of the 2016 Hop Festival.
